Is Melania Trump’s Citizen Status Legitimate?

July 16, 2019 by The Staff

Many have questioned how legitimate Melina Trump’s citizenship is.

Melania Trump’s own immigration path also has been scrutinized. The first lady, formerly a model known as Melania Knauss, arrived in New York in 1996 and began dating Trump in 2000.7

In 2001, she [Melania Trump] was granted a green card in the elite EB-1 program, which was designed for renowned academic researchers, multinational business executives or those in other fields, such as Olympic athletes and Oscar-winning actors, who demonstrated “sustained national and international acclaim.”

The EB-1 program, also called with “Einstein” citizenship path, has very specific qualifications. Read them for yourself directly on the official website of the U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services’ website.
